One more Salford Shooting are we losing control of our streets.

Raiders shot a dog and stabbed two men in a frenzied attack on two homes.

A 45-year-old man is in a serious condition in hospital after being repeatedly knifed when the gang of four or five men broke into his home on Haddon Street, Lower Broughton, in Salford, at around 8.20pm last night.

The man’s Staffordshire Bull Terrier has undergone emergency surgery to remove a bullet from its body, but is expected to survive.

A 33-year-old neighbour was also taken to hospital with a stab wound to his hand after the gang went on to force their way into his home.

The attackers had fled by the time armed response officers arrived at the scene and police are now appealing for witness to help them establish the circumstances surrounding the incident
